欢迎访问宙启技术站
智能推送

使用 PHP 的 array_push 函数向数组添加元素

发布时间:2023-09-29 04:49:34

array_push 函数可以用于向数组的末尾添加一个或多个元素。它接受两个参数, 个参数是要添加元素的数组,第二个参数是要添加到数组结尾的元素或元素的列表。

使用 array_push 函数添加元素非常简单。首先,我们需要创建一个数组。可以通过多种方式创建数组,比如使用 array 关键字或直接使用方括号。

// 创建一个空数组
$myArray = array();

// 创建一个包含元素的数组
$myArray = array(1, 2, 3);

// 创建一个关联数组
$myArray = array("name" => "John", "age" => 25);

接下来,我们可以使用 array_push 函数向数组添加元素。以下示例演示如何使用 array_push 将元素添加到数组末尾。

// 创建一个空数组
$myArray = array();

// 使用 array_push 添加一个元素
array_push($myArray, "apple");

// 输出数组
print_r($myArray);
// 输出:Array ( [0] => apple )

// 使用 array_push 添加多个元素
array_push($myArray, "banana", "orange");

// 输出数组
print_r($myArray);
// 输出:Array ( [0] => apple [1] => banana [2] => orange )

上述示例中,我们首先创建一个空数组 $myArray。然后,使用 array_push 将元素 "apple" 添加到数组中。使用 print_r 函数输出数组,我们可以看到数组中现在有一个元素 "apple"

接下来,我们使用 array_push 添加了两个额外的元素 "banana""orange" 到数组中。再次使用 print_r 函数输出数组,我们可以看到数组中现在有三个元素 "apple", "banana", 和 "orange"

需要注意的是,array_push 函数会修改原始数组,并在数组的末尾添加新元素。如果要添加的元素是一个数组或另一个对象,它将作为一个整体添加到原始数组中。